Concrete foundation sealing services involve applying protective coatings or sealants to the exterior or interior surfaces of a building's foundation. This process helps create a barrier against moisture, water infiltration, and other environmental elements that can compromise the integrity of the foundation over time. The sealing materials used are typically designed to withstand the pressures of soil movement, temperature changes, and water exposure, ensuring that the foundation remains durable and stable for years to come. Proper sealing can also help prevent cracks from expanding and reduce the risk of water-related damages that might lead to more extensive repairs.
One of the primary issues that foundation sealing addresses is water intrusion, which can cause significant damage to a property's structural components and interior spaces. Moisture seeping through unprotected foundations can lead to mold growth, wood rot, and deterioration of building materials. Additionally, water infiltration can cause soil erosion around the foundation, leading to shifting or settling that compromises stability. Foundation sealing services are designed to mitigate these problems by creating a moisture-resistant barrier, helping to maintain the property's structural integrity and prevent costly repairs caused by water damage.
Properties that typically benefit from foundation sealing include residential homes, especially those with basements or crawl spaces, as well as commercial buildings and industrial facilities. Homes built in areas with high water tables, frequent rainfall, or poor drainage are often prime candidates for sealing services. Additionally, properties with existing cracks or signs of moisture intrusion may require sealing to prevent further deterioration. Commercial properties, such as warehouses or retail spaces, also utilize foundation sealing to protect their investments from moisture-related issues that could interrupt operations or lead to structural concerns.

Cost Range for Sealing - The typical cost for concrete foundation sealing services varies based on the project's size and complexity. Expect prices to range from $500 to $2,500 for standard residential foundations. Larger or more intricate projects may cost more depending on specific needs.
Factors Influencing Price - Material choices and surface conditions can impact sealing costs. For example, sealing a basement foundation in Easton, PA, might cost around $1,200, while more extensive sealing for commercial properties could reach $4,000 or higher.
Average Service Charges - Most homeowners pay between $1,000 and $2,000 for professional concrete sealing. This includes surface preparation, application, and curing time, with prices varying by local contractor rates and project scope.
Additional Cost Considerations - Extra services such as crack repairs or waterproofing may increase overall costs. For instance, crack repairs could add approximately $300 to $700 to the total sealing expense, depending on severity and size.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is concrete foundation sealing? Concrete foundation sealing involves applying protective coatings or treatments to prevent water infiltration, reduce moisture issues, and protect the foundation from damage.
Why should I consider sealing my foundation? Sealing can help prevent water leaks, reduce the risk of cracks, and extend the lifespan of a foundation, especially in areas prone to moisture or heavy rainfall.
How often should foundation sealing be performed? The frequency of sealing depends on the type of sealant used and local conditions, but it is generally recommended every few years for optimal protection.
What types of sealants are used for foundation sealing? Common sealants include waterproof coatings, elastomeric paints, and sealant membranes, each chosen based on the specific needs of the foundation.
